Club Brugge midfielder Raphael Onyedika is moving closer to a permanent transfer to Eintracht Frankfurt as negotiations advance between the Belgian Pro League champions and the German Bundesliga club. Multiple reports indicate that discussions have intensified during the ongoing transfer window, potentially resolving a long-running saga surrounding the Nigeria international’s future at Jan Breydel Stadium.

Frankfurt emerges as frontrunner for Onyedika

The potential departure of Onyedika marks a significant moment for Club Brugge as the club shapes its squad for the remainder of the season. According to reports from regional and national sports outlets, the defensive midfielder has drawn sustained interest from several European sides across successive transfer periods, with Frankfurt emerging as the frontrunner to secure a deal.

Scherpen targets Ipswich Town move

Meanwhile, movement elsewhere in Belgian football involves Union Saint-Gilloise goalkeeper Kjell Scherpen, who is reportedly on the verge of a transfer to EFL Championship side Ipswich Town.
